Approaches for Removing Contaminants and Debris
Successful strategies for extracting debris and contaminants from aquatic bodies play a critical role in maintaining water quality and ecosystem health. Among the most widely-used methods are mechanical removal and chemical treatments. Mechanical removal involves utilizing specialized equipment, such as skimmers and dredgers, to physically pull out debris like leaves, algae, and sediment from the water. This approach limits disruption to the aquatic environment while effectively diminishing pollutant levels.
Chemical treatments, such as algaecides and herbicides, can target specific contaminants but need to be utilized cautiously to avoid harming non-target species. Biological methods, such as introducing beneficial microorganisms, present an sustainable alternative for breaking down organic waste and pollutants.
Routine monitoring of water quality can guide the implementation of these methods, ensuring excellent results. By utilizing a combination of these techniques, pond and lake managers can substantially improve the health and sustainability of aquatic ecosystems.

Boosting Water Quality for Wildlife
Although the health of aquatic ecosystems is essential for supporting varied wildlife, enhancing water quality remains a key challenge for pond and lake managers. High nutrient levels, often stemming from runoff, can cause harmful algal blooms that diminish oxygen and jeopardize aquatic life. Proven management practices emphasize reducing these nutrient inputs through buffer zones and sediment control.
Moreover, preserving proper pH levels and temperature is essential for the longevity of sensitive species. Supervisors often observe these parameters carefully to secure a balanced ecosystem. The addition of native plant species can enhance water filtration and provide habitats for fish and invertebrates, additionally supporting biodiversity.
Periodic assessments and changes to management strategies are necessary, as conditions can alter swiftly. Ultimately, the commitment to elevating water quality not only benefits wildlife but also boosts the recreational value of water bodies for the area population.

Environmentally Safe Cleaning Methods
Sustainable pond and lake management increasingly emphasizes natural cleaning methods, which harness the power of ecosystems to reinstate water quality without harmful chemicals. These methods include the introduction of beneficial bacteria and enzymes that break down organic matter, thereby promoting a balanced ecosystem. Aquatic plants perform a critical function by absorbing excess nutrients, which aids in managing algae growth. Additionally, utilizing natural predators, such as fish species that consume unwanted pests, can maintain a healthy aquatic environment. Regularly aerating the water enhances oxygen levels, enabling the breakdown of pollutants. By incorporating these natural techniques, water bodies can achieve improved clarity and health while preserving the delicate balance of their ecosystems, ultimately resulting in sustainable and effective management practices.

Proactive Maintenance Methods
While sustaining pristine and healthy aquatic ecosystems may be demanding, establishing preventive maintenance practices secures long-term sustainability for ponds and lakes. Consistent evaluation of water quality, including pH and nutrient levels, aids in detecting potential issues before they escalate. Establishing a routine schedule for debris removal and vegetation management limits the buildup of organic matter, promoting better water circulation. Additionally, applying eco-friendly techniques such as bioengineering or natural filtration systems promotes a balanced ecosystem. Teaching local communities about responsible practices, such as reducing chemical runoff and proper waste disposal, further supports these efforts. By focusing on preventive maintenance, pond and lake managers can successfully boost water quality, protect biodiversity, and guarantee these essential resources remain healthy for future generations.
